[Answer] You spray your lawn with a pesticide such that the concentration of the pesticide in thetissues of the grass on your lawn is 10-6 parts per million (ppm). Grasshoppers eat thegrass and are in turn eaten by rats which are then eaten by owls. Keeping in mind thatroughly 10% of the energy at a trophic level is transferred to the next highest trophiclevel what do you estimate to be the concentration of the pesticide in the tissues of theowls?A) 10-2 ppm B) 10-3 ppm C) 10-4 ppm D) 10-5 ppm E) 10-6 ppm

Answer: C
